Determination Of A Permanent Name For The Southport Cultural Centre

The Committee considered the report of the Strategic Director – People seeking determination of a permanent name for the Southport Cultural Centre.
The report indicated that the following suggestions had been made from members of the public:-
· (Royal) Cambridge Halls
· Atkinson Cultural Centre
· Atkinson Centre
· Southport Heritage Centre
· The Atkinson
· Atkinson Civic Centre
· Cambridge Cultural Centre
and recommended that due to the generous contribution by the original benefactor William Atkinson to Southport’s cultural facilities, that were still enjoyed today, he be recognised in the ‘brand’ name of ‘The Atkinson’ being applied to the whole complex.
The Committee also considered a suggestion submitted as part of the Public Forum that the applied name be either the Atkinson Art Gallery or the Atkinson Library at the Cambridge Cultural Centre (Minute No. 105 (a) refers).
RESOLVED:
That Cabinet be recommended to name the Southport Cultural Centre “The Atkinson”.
